Output e5e50285affe128faba8761a39e9eb88e2ea87ac7fcaa9802c4e42b2b480f784:1

value
8339639
script pubkey
OP_0 OP_PUSHBYTES_32 1d8d1da843ccc1f3589e893ee7b25eed494de695ed76353d9eca905be70d3ee4
address
bc1qrkx3m2zrenqlxky73ylw0vj7a4y5me54a4mr20v7e2g9hecd8mjqxsgeht
transaction
e5e50285affe128faba8761a39e9eb88e2ea87ac7fcaa9802c4e42b2b480f784
confirmations
158445
spent
true